Syron
Daisy Syron Russell, formerly known mononymously as Syron, is an English singer from London with plays on both Radio 1 and 1Xtra, and classed as "one to watch" by MTV and named "one of 2012’s coolest new female talents" by ID magazine. Her music has been blogged by The xx, and Idolator, as well as tweeted about by Danny Brown. Popjustice is also a fan.

The Story of Syron
Syron first appeared in U.S. Social Security Administration records as a baby boy name in 1975, with 5 babies given the name that year. Its peak popularity came in 1975, when 5 Syrons were born — ranking #5,464 that year. As of 2026, Syron ranks #5,464 for baby boys with 5 births, with steady use. In total, more than 5 Syrons have been born in the U.S. since records began in 1880, spanning the 1970s through the 2020s.
